The Space-Mean Speed for the six vehicles is: v s = 6 (1/55 + 1/53 + 1/50 + 1/47 + 1/45 + 1/44) = 48.7 mph Free Flow Speed ( vf) The average speed that a motorist would travel if there were no congestion or other adverse conditions (i.e. . Space Mean Speed Space mean speed also averages spot speeds but spatial weights is given instead of temporal. Because Space mean speed is rigorously defined as the average speed of vehicles running on a road segment of a certain length at a given instant, whereas time mean speed is defined as the average speed of vehicles crossing a cross-section of road during a certain period.
